Virat Kohli created a new record as soon as he took the field against New Zealand in Vadodara. He has now joined the top-5 list of players who have played the most number of ODI International matches for India. India vs New Zealand 1st ODI is being played at BCA Stadium in Vadodara.
Virat Kohli has played 309 ODI international matches for Team India. He has left behind former Indian captain Sourav Ganguly in this matter. Ganguly played 308 ODI matches for India. Kohli can also leave behind Rahul Dravid and Mohammad Azharuddin in the coming days. Azharuddin has played 334 ODI matches and Dravid has played 340 ODI matches.
Sachin Tendulkar at number one
The player who has played the most ODI international matches for India is Sachin Tendulkar, who played 463 matches. This is also a world record, he is the player who has played the most ODIs in the world. MS Dhoni is second among those who have played the most ODIs for India, under whose captaincy India won the 2011 ODI World Cup. Dhoni has played 347 ODI international matches.
Most ODI matches for India
- Sachin Tendulkar- 463
- MS Dhoni- 347
- Rahul Dravid- 340
- Mohammad Azharuddin- 334
- Virat Kohli- 309*
- Sourav Ganguly- 308
This record is on the target of Virat Kohli
India has got a target of 301 runs to win in the first ODI being played in Vadodara. Batting first, New Zealand scored 300 runs. Even with the bat, Virat Kohli can make many records in this match. If he scores 42 runs, he will leave Kumar Sangakkara behind in terms of scoring the most runs in international cricket.
Currently Kumar Sangakkara has 28016 runs. Virat Kohli has scored 27975 runs in 556 matches, he is just 41 runs behind Sangakkara. Sangakkara is the second batsman in the world to score the most runs in international cricket. Sachin is at number one with 34357 runs. If he scores 94 runs, he will become the batsman who has scored the most runs in ODI against New Zealand, currently this record is in the name of Sachin.
